Also: Angela is 100% gonna try to reach out to Elias Thorne on our next TikTok Live, isn't she... GEMINI SUMMARY: This episode of Paranormal Lens explores the provocative question: Is AI an egregore? The hosts discuss whether human interaction with artificial intelligence is collectively feeding a new thoughtform, or if we are simply projecting occult concepts onto modern technology (2:03-4:28). Key themes and discussion points: Defining Egregores: The hosts describe an egregore as a "thoughtform" created by collective human belief and intent, which then takes on a life of its own (2:38-3:40). They draw parallels between this concept and the way people interact with AI, treating it like a conscious entity that learns from human input (5:21-6:06). The "Cloud" Analogy: The hosts compare AI, such as ChatGPT, to entities like the Hatman, suggesting that while individuals experience different versions of these "entities" based on their own personal inputs (algorithms), there is a collective "cloud" engine that connects them all (8:03-8:59). Shadow Self and Reflection: The discussion touches on the idea that AI acts as a "mirror" for human nature, potentially reflecting our fears, shadows, and subconscious intent, similar to how occultists view the interaction between a practitioner and an egregore (9:33-10:40). AI Inbreeding: The hosts discuss a recent Cornell University study mentioned in The Guardian regarding "AI inbreeding," where AI models generated consistent, fabricated stories about a non-existent person named Elias Thorne (22:04-23:45). They debate whether this phenomenon is a technological glitch or, in a paranormal sense, the birth of a new entity (24:36-25:27). Consciousness vs. Metaphor: The group remains skeptical about whether AI currently possesses actual consciousness but finds the metaphor for how these systems propagate through human belief and data extremely compelling (6:19-6:41; 16:44-18:11). The episode concludes by pondering if modern "shadow beings" might effectively be algorithms existing within our collective digital landscape (30:16-30:43).
